Start the day at a neighborhood bakery

Order pão na chapa, strong coffee, and a quick pastry at a local padaria. The counter rhythm gives you an easy read on the morning pace in Serra.

Pick up produce at the local market

Wander through a neighborhood market for fruit, greens, and household staples. Regular shoppers chat with vendors while baskets fill with the week’s basics.

Linger over lunch at a self-service restaurant

Join the weekday flow at a self-service spot, where lunch is practical and unhurried. Plates tend to mix rice, beans, salad, and a hot dish.

Pause for coffee after errands

Take a coffee break at a simple corner cafe or lanchonete. It is a familiar reset between appointments, shopping, and transit around Serra.

Annual events worth planning around

Carnaval de Serra

Street parades and blocos fill the calendar around February, with neighborhood celebrations across the municipality.

Festa de São Benedito de Nova Almeida

A traditional religious celebration each January, centered on music, processions, and local devotion.

Festival de Jazz e Blues de Manguinhos

A music festival held in the winter months, bringing live performances and food to the area.

Festa de Nossa Senhora da Conceição

An annual December celebration with processions and community gatherings honoring the city’s patron saint.

Is Serra walkable, or will I need a car?

You can walk for nearby errands, meals, and short neighborhood plans in some parts of Serra, but a car or rideshare is often more practical for getting between areas. If your schedule includes multiple stops or you want to move around on your own timeline, plan on using transit or driving. Check your listing for parking, since it varies by building.
